Among the most versatile and effective are polyether modified silicone oils, which serve critical roles as substrate wetting agents and leveling agents in various coating systems.
The unique structure of polyether modified silicone oils allows them to combine the benefits of both silicone and polyether chemistries. This dual nature makes them highly effective in addressing complex formulation challenges. In the context of industrial coatings, their primary function as substrate wetting agents is to reduce the surface tension of liquid formulations. This is particularly important for waterborne coatings, which often struggle with high surface tension, leading to poor wetting of low-surface-energy substrates.
By significantly lowering surface tension, these silicone oils ensure that coatings spread easily and evenly across challenging surfaces, promoting superior adhesion and preventing defects such as crawling and fisheyes. The ability to reduce surface tension for improved wetting is a hallmark of these products. Their effectiveness extends to enhancing flow and leveling properties, contributing to a smoother, defect-free surface finish.
Furthermore, the polyether component can be tailored to improve compatibility with different resin systems, making them suitable for a wide range of applications, from automotive finishes to architectural paints and inks. This versatility ensures that formulators can achieve desired performance characteristics across diverse coating types.
